Bitdefender MDR Wins Tech Innovators Award

We are proud to announce that Bitdefender MDR won the 2020 CRN Tech Innovator Award in the Security – Managed Detection & Response category.

CRN evaluated Bitdefender against other MDR vendors for uniqueness, key capabilities, technological competency, addressing customer needs and other criteria.

Our MDR service was recognized as innovative for the following reasons:

  • First and only MDR solution to combine Human Risk Analytics
  • Event correlation from Endpoint, Network, Cloud and Bitdefender Global Threat Intelligence that correlates cyber-attack information from over 500 million sensors around the world
  • Over 70 years of combined threat hunting experience delivered by Bitdefender Security Analysts from National Intelligence Agencies.
  • Playbooks defined based on Active Defense strategies the Security Analysts have learned in defending against nation states.

Bitdefender Managed Detection and Response (MDR) service gives our customers 24x7x365 proactive cybersecurity operations. The service combines award-winning Bitdefender security technologies for endpoints, network and cloud workloads with threat-hunting expertise of skilled analysts from global Intelligence Agencies.

In addition to our world-class Security Operations Center, our security analysts can focus on the most critical security incidents by tapping tunable machine learning, which forms part of the multiple security layers of the Bitdefender Unified Risk and Analytics solution. Hyper Detect gives administrators the ability to configure supervised and unsupervised machine learning-based anomaly detection.

The machine learning-based detection module includes detection of suspicious files and suspicious command line execution (e.g. cmd, PowerShell, etc.). The configurations provide a list of five categories of attacks and the administrator can fine-tune the aggressiveness of the machine learning model based on the type of threat.
